What is $2,267,620 After Taxes in New Jersey?

A $2,267,620 salary in New Jersey takes home $1,201,839 after federal income tax, state income tax, and FICA — a 47.0% effective tax rate.

Annual Take-Home Pay
$1,201,839
after $1,065,781 in total taxes (47.0% effective rate)

New Jersey Tax Overview

New Jersey applies a top marginal income tax rate of 10.8% on the highest earners. The graduated bracket structure means most middle-income earners face effective state rates well below the headline number.
